Output 905abe81255c3d792551a78a7e4615033d459b488a34302b05addb2380fcd09d:0

value
367639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a1bc17caadea78257be805f29cc8e67d9603eee OP_EQUAL
address
3CpfcTK2MzaxGgnu2AqLUdiitGiWSHGz6Z
transaction
905abe81255c3d792551a78a7e4615033d459b488a34302b05addb2380fcd09d
spent
true